Full Job Description

Location: Sydney, NSW, Australia

Bring your expertise to a Trading Services team supporting foreign exchange trading activity and operational excellence.
Youll work across trading, sales, and operations partners to help ensure trades, controls, and reconciliations are completed accurately and on time.
This role offers broad exposure to trading products and end-to-end trade support, with opportunities to contribute to process improvements and strategic initiatives.

As a Trading Services Professional on the Sydney Foreign Exchange Middle Office team, you will support electronic trading activity and the foreign exchange voice sales desk by ensuring trades and orders are accurately captured, amended, and controlled. 
You will monitor and manage foreign exchange exposure in line with desk expectations and complete intraday and end-of-day checks to maintain book integrity.
You will partner closely with operations and infrastructure teams to resolve queries and help deliver a strong control environment.

Job Responsibilities:

  • Capture transactions in risk management systems accurately and within required timelines.
  • Amend and maintain deals and orders to ensure accurate representation of trading activity.
  • Monitor and manage foreign exchange exposure to align with desk expectations.
  • Perform intraday and end-of-day completeness and reconciliation checks to support accurate processing and book management.
  • Execute control checks diligently, including timely completion and sign-off.
  • Coordinate with operations and infrastructure partners to support efficient issue resolution and a one team operating model.
  • Communicate clearly with internal stakeholders to ensure timely responses to trade, booking, and control queries.
  • Contribute to strategic initiatives and continuous improvement efforts across processes and business architecture.
  • Build and maintain working knowledge of foreign exchange products and trading structures from financial and operational perspectives.

 

Required qualifications, capabilities, and skills

  • Demonstrated understanding of foreign exchange fundamentals and risk concepts relevant to trade support.
  • Knowledge of front-to-back trade lifecycle processes, including confirmations and settlements.
  • Ability to complete reconciliations and control checks with accuracy and strong attention to detail.
  • Strong written and verbal communication skills to support collaborative problem-solving.
  • Strong analytical and numerical skills to support exposure monitoring and issue investigation.
  • Proficiency in Microsoft Excel to analyze data and support daily processes.

 

Preferred qualifications, capabilities, and skills

  • Knowledge of derivatives and hedging products (for example, interest rate swaps and bonds).
  • Experience working in a fast-paced environment with shifting priorities.
  • Demonstrated problem-solving skills and experience contributing to process improvement or project work.
  • Working knowledge of VBA, Python, or Alteryx.
